Previously my car had recorded peak airflow across the maf of 197g/s, immediately this has increased to a new peak of 213g/s from the logging I did on my way home, so a very health increase of a stage 1 mapped car.  :happy2:

i tried this on standard map and to be honest was very little difference. maybe slightly more top end pull

with a remap there is more top end but for me its too noisy.

If the car is standard (software wise) then there is no point in fitting the intake as the ECU will map out the increased airflow.

On a remapped car it will make a healthy difference.

This is a margin price for one of these as they aren't going to be available from ITG directly anymore, only VW Racing will be selling them in the future so prices will be higher.
